Safety Lanyards for Fall Arrest, Restraint and Positioning
The right lanyard depends on how the user is working, what anchor point is available and how the wider fall protection system is set up. We help customers choose suitable configurations without losing sight of day-to-day usability.
Our range includes Ridgegear fall arrest lanyards, restraint lanyards and positioning lanyards for industrial, maintenance, utilities and construction environments. Nationwide supply, installation and testing available where the lanyard selection forms part of a wider equipment package.

Examples
- Single-leg fall arrest lanyards
- Twin-leg 100% tie-off lanyards
- Work restraint and adjustable lanyards
- Elasticated and tie-back lanyard options
